CORRECTED: Italy — not Czech Republic or Austria — represents Slovakia for Schengen visa matters in Bangladesh, confirmed directly on Slovakia's own MFA website. Bangladeshi applicants apply at the Embassy of Italy, Dhaka (not via New Delhi). Standard Schengen (C) visa fee unchanged at EUR 90 (~USD 104 / ~BDT 12,864).
Visa types: Schengen C visa: Tourist, Business, Family/Friends Visit, Transit, Cultural/Sports, Medical (all via Italy's representation). National D visa: Student, Worker, EU Blue Card, Family Reunification, Long-term Residence, Researcher, Self-employment (via Slovak Embassy New Delhi directly, not via Italy).

Schengen Airport Transit Visa (Type A) - required for Bangladeshi passport holders changing planes airside at a Slovakia airport en route to a non-Schengen third country. Keeps you airside; does not permit entry into Slovakia or the Schengen Area.
